In N4169 the author dropped the invoke<R> support by claiming that it's an unnecessary cruft in TR1, obsoleted by C++11 type inference. But now we have some new business went to *INVOKE*(f, t1, t2, ..., tN, R), that is to discard the return type when R is void. This form is very useful, or possible even more useful than the basic form when implementing a call wrapper. Also note that the optional R support is already in std::is_callable and std::is_nothrow_callable.
